I will be proposing next week and am really excited.

here are the stats:

1.03 asscher cut, E VS1 GIA
meas: 5.70 x 5.59 x 3.75
depth 67.1%
Table 69%
Girdle slightly thick to thick
Culet none
Polish good
symmetry good
fluorescence none

the band is white gold 14k ring weight 4.1 grams
the setting has 29 round brilliant cut diamonds measuring 1.8mm weighing .77ct G color VS/SI1

bought it at a jeweler who custom made it.


anyone know roughly what this would go for?
